App blocker safety in plain terms

App blockers are usually safe when they come from official app stores, have a clear developer identity, and are configured to block only what they need to block. The practical trust standard is simple: fewer permissions, clearer data practices, and easy ways to undo the setup.

Most risk comes from privacy, permissions, and developer trust. A blocker may need to know which apps you open, when sessions start, or whether a distracting site should be blocked. That is normal for focus tools, but it is still personal behavioral data.

Five app blocker safety facts to check first

  • Mainstream blockers usually use standard controls. Reputable Android and iOS blockers often rely on operating-system tools such as usage access, screen time APIs, notifications, or network rules.
  • Privacy is the main safety issue. Device damage is unlikely with trusted blockers; exposure of app use, schedules, and focus behavior is the bigger concern.
  • High-privilege permissions need scrutiny. Accessibility, VPN, DNS filtering, and device-admin controls can be legitimate, but they deserve a slower review.
  • Narrow blocking is safer. Focus workflows are safest when they target specific apps, websites, and notifications instead of taking broad system control.
  • Trust signals should be checked. Read the privacy policy, update history, encryption claims, developer name, and independent reviews before relying on a blocker.

App blocker controls on phones and computers

App blockers work by enforcing rules, not by understanding your intent. They apply timing, app lists, schedules, website filters, or device limits after you define what should be restricted.

How app blockers work depends on the platform. Android blockers may use usage access to detect opened apps, accessibility services to enforce overlays, or VPN and DNS filtering to block web traffic. iOS blockers often rely on Screen Time-style controls, content filters, and notification settings. Desktop blockers may use browser extensions, local network rules, or background helper apps.

Each method has a trade-off. A browser extension may see visited pages. A VPN-style blocker may handle network requests. Notification controls may expose alert content. The red due-date banner on the portal is not the same as a game notification, but a blocker only follows the rules you set.

Blocking app permissions that deserve extra caution

Some blocking app permissions are normal for focus tools, while others should make you pause. Usage access can be necessary because the blocker needs to detect when a restricted app opens, but unrelated access to contacts, SMS, microphone, camera, or precise location is a warning sign unless the app explains it clearly.

App blocker data risks in anti-procrastination workflows

App blockers become more privacy-sensitive when they sit inside a larger anti-procrastination workflow. Blocked apps, focus sessions, habits, streaks, task names, missed reminders, and late-night work patterns can reveal stress, school pressure, work habits, or health-related routines.

That data deserves the same care as other personal behavioral data. A half-organized task list with color labels but no first action selected says more than “productivity.” It can show avoidance patterns, deadlines, and the times a person struggles to start.

Students may expose class schedules. Remote workers may expose client rhythms. ADHD adults may use these tools for external structure, but the app should not turn support data into unnecessary profiling. Any focus blocker should be judged by the same privacy questions: what is collected, why, where it goes, and how long it stays.

Evidence behind app blockers and digital self-control

People use app blockers because phone use is hard to self-regulate when cues are constant. Pew Research Center reported that 31% of U.S. adults were online “almost constantly” in 2019 (https://www.pewresearch.org/internet/2019/07/25/mobile-technology-and-home-broadband-2019/), and a separate Pew teen survey found that 54% of U.S. teens felt they spent too much time on their phones (https://www.pewresearch.org/internet/2018/05/31/teens-social-media-technology-2018/).

Research also supports careful use of digital self-control tools. A 2018 systematic review in the Journal of Medical Internet Research found that mobile phone-based interventions can reduce problematic smartphone use and improve self-control (https://www.jmir.org/2018/1/e4/). A 2019 randomized trial in Computers in Human Behavior found that smartphone self-control tools reduced social media use for participants and were linked with improved subjective well-being (https://doi.org/10.1016/j.chb.2019.02.016).

Common app blocker safety myths

  • Myth 1: App store approval means every blocker is safe. Store review helps, but it does not replace checking permissions, developer history, reviews, and data practices.
  • Myth 2: Blockers only see app names. Some blockers may also access usage timing, notification content, browser activity, or network requests depending on design.
  • Myth 3: Accessibility and VPN permissions are harmless. These controls can be legitimate, but they are high-privilege access points and should not be granted casually.
  • Myth 4: Blockers solve procrastination by themselves. Blocking removes one trigger; it does not choose the next visible action or reduce task ambiguity.
  • Myth 5: More restriction always means more focus. Over-blocking can create panic, workarounds, or missed responsibilities.

Safer app blocker setup for focus sessions

Use an app blocker by starting narrow, then adding restrictions only when the first setup is not enough. Broad blocking feels decisive, but it can break school, work, banking, maps, health, or emergency communication at the wrong moment.

  1. Choose the distraction. Block the two or three apps that most often interrupt task initiation.
  2. Set a short schedule. Start with one focus block, such as 25 minutes, instead of an all-day lockout.
  3. Keep essentials available. Allow school portals, work chat, banking, maps, health tools, and emergency contacts when needed.
  4. Add an escape option. Use a delay, passcode, or emergency override so misconfiguration does not trap you.
  5. Review permissions after updates. Check access again after installation, major releases, or device changes.

FAQ

Are app blockers safe?

Reputable app blockers are generally safe when they come from trusted developers, request reasonable permissions, and explain their privacy practices clearly. Safety depends on configuration as much as the app itself.

Can app blockers steal data?

Malicious or poorly secured blockers could expose data, especially if granted VPN, accessibility, notification, or device-admin access. Review the developer, privacy policy, permissions, and update history first.

What permissions do blockers need?

Common blocker permissions include usage access, notification controls, screen time APIs, VPN, DNS filtering, or accessibility access depending on platform. A blocker should not request unrelated permissions without a clear reason.

Is accessibility permission risky?

Accessibility permission is powerful because it can observe or control screen behavior. Grant it only to trusted apps that clearly explain why it is needed.

Is VPN blocking safe?

VPN-based blocking can be legitimate, but it may route or filter network activity depending on design. Check whether browsing data, domains, or traffic logs are collected.

Can blockers damage my phone?

Reputable blockers are unlikely to damage a phone. Misconfiguration can still cause lockout, missed alerts, or blocked access to needed apps.
